What Are Web3 TLDs and Why Do They Struggle on the Classic Web?

Web3 TLDs offer a fresh take on domains. You mint them on Freename as NFTs. Think .brand or .art. Ownership lasts forever with no renewal fees. You control subdomains and earn royalties from sales. However, these TLDs hit roadblocks on the classic web. Standard browsers like Chrome ignore them. Why? They rely on blockchain resolution instead of traditional DNS. As a result, most users see errors. Sites stay hidden without extra tools.

Common Hurdles for Web3 Domains in Everyday Browsers

Chrome and Firefox lack native support for Web3 TLDs. Browsers check DNS servers by default. They skip blockchain queries entirely. So, your .brand site fails to load. Users get a "not found" message every time.

Classic tools miss WHOIS data too. Traditional lookups return blank results. This happens because Freename stores info on the blockchain. It's normal and expected. No red flag here.

You often need Web3 wallets or extensions. Tools like Freename Extension or MetaMask Snap help. But most people avoid them. They stick to everyday browsing. Therefore, Web3 domains vanish for the average user.

Search engines overlook them as well. Google ignores blockchain names. DNS checkers show nothing. Again, that's standard for Freename TLDs. These barriers block traffic. Your audience can't find or visit without hassle. How do you reach them?

Earn Passive Income from Your TLD Royalties

You mint a TLD like .yourbrand on Freename's blockchain. Then activate ICANN Bridge. Registrars such as GoDaddy start selling subdomains. Think shop.yourbrand or blog.yourbrand. Each registration pays the registry about $9 to $10 per year. Freename deducts ICANN fees first. Fixed costs hit around $25,800 yearly. Transaction fees add $0.26 per domain after high volumes. Operations take a cut too.

After that, you claim 50% to 80% royalties on net profits. For example, 10,000 registrations generate $100,000 gross. Fees and costs leave over $50,000. Your share flows to your wallet automatically. No extra work needed. Registrars manage sales and renewals. Popular TLDs scale big. Millions roll in for top ones.

Meanwhile, bridge your TLD cheap. Minting starts at $79. Bridging shares costs. Income starts fast. Customers buy subdomains without wallets. Your passive stream grows as registrations climb. Doesn't that beat yearly domain bills?
